WATCH: 'Twayiseko dda', Alien Skin's banger lights up Kigali as Uganda stun Senegal
As the Uganda Women's basketball team, the Gazelles stunned heavyweights Senegal 85-83 in the ongoing FIBA Women's Afrobasket, the post-match reactions told the exact tale.
Filled in wild celebrations, the Gazelles, backed by a predominantly Rwandan and Ugandan audience, jammed to some of Uganda's finest sounds at the BK Arena, Kigali on Saturday.
From Nutty Neithan's 'Walk to Work" to Alien Skin's 'Twayiseko dda', the joyous crowd swayed, whirled and danced wildly.

The celebrations were justified as the Gazelles' win was against an 11-time champion, tipped by a vast majority to take the day and the tournament altogether.

To add, the victory also came on the back of an agonizing opening day 66-80 defeat to Mali on Friday.
